The Ecology Center to host Green Feast on Sept. 8

Share

The Ecology Center, Orange County’s premiere environmental education group, will host its fourth annual Green Feast on Saturday, Sept. 8, at its lush San Juan Capistrano facility.

More than 200 people will sit at a lavish outdoor table feasting on a bounty of appetizers and a family-style, four-course dinner made by notable area chefs using farm-fresh, organic ingredients sourced from within a 200-mile radius.

Chefs include Matt Tobin (True Foods Kitchen), Justin Miller (Pizzeria Ortica), Erika Tucker (the Cellar), Ryan Adams (370 Common) and Casey Overton (Montage Resort).

Advertisement

The dinner will kick off with something called “The Eco App Off,” which allows guests to pick their favorite appetizers from those prepared by the chefs. There will also be a silent auction for special chef dinners to benefit the center.

Wine, of course, will play a celebrated role at the dinner, with Edward Sellers Vineyard & Wines, Tablas Creek Vineyard and Oso Libre Winery adding the appropriate Dionysian dash of fun to the night’s proceedings.

Tickets for Green Feast are $180 per person for members of the Ecology Center; tickets for nonmembers are $225. Membership starts at $50 per person.
